The Big Five: The Engines of Global Warming

Climate change isn’t a vague phenomenon; it has a clear industrial footprint. The overwhelming majority of global emissions are driven by five core pillars of modern civilization:

  • The Energy & Mobility Grid: The burning of fossil fuels for electricity, industrial heating, and global transportation systems remains the primary driver.
  • Ecological Liquidation: Deforestation and land-use changes that destroy forests, wetlands, and peatlands effectively obliterating the planet’s vital, natural carbon-absorbing infrastructure.
  • Heavy Industry & Manufacturing: High-heat chemical processes required to produce foundational materials like cement, steel, and plastics.
  • Industrialized Agriculture & Livestock: Massive-scale food production systems that release immense volumes of highly potent gases, specifically methane and nitrous oxide.
  • Linear Waste Management: Overstrained landfills and waste systems that emit massive plumes of methane as organic material rots in anaerobic conditions.

The Interconnected Solution: A Systemic Overhaul

What makes climate change unique is that its causes are hardwired into nearly every facet of modern life. Because the problem is deeply interconnected, our solutions cannot be siloed.

True sustainability requires a multi-lever attack. We cannot just deploy renewable energy while continuing to clear forests. We cannot just green our supply chains while ignoring waste.
